我目前正在使用此代码设置div的图像背景:
$('.sample_image').css('background-image', 'url('+ $(this).attr("src") +')');
我们使用这个,所以当用户点击图像颜色样本时,它会将其设置为背景图像,以便他们可以更好地查看产品。
问题是一些图像样本有2种颜色,以显示次要颜色。我需要只显示左侧的颜色(左上角的像素。)
这可以用JQuery吗?
答案 0 :(得分:0)
你必须使用<canvas>
,所以不,不只是使用jQuery。
基本上,您将图像转移到画布元素,然后您可以从那里使用它。可能有插件可以执行此操作,但它只适用于现代浏览器。